I don't understand the strategy here. You've got a 20-man roster and no cap space, so it makes sense to trade Kerfoot away and use that $3.5 million to bring in four players at $850,000 or less each. Instead, you've exchanged one year of Kerfoot for two seasons of Crouse at the same cap hit, thereby extending your problem another year plus bringing Crouse straight to free agency. That trade would barely make sense if Crouse was an appreciable upgrade over Kerfoot, but I don't know that you'll get many people to agree with you there. Plus, you've compounded the error by paying Hirvonen and a first-round draft pick for the exchange.
I don't get this at all.
